# Runbook: Merlow dedupe release

Scope: customer-record deduplication batch (Merlow v1.9).

1. Freeze writes to the Harrick customer store.
2. Run the dry-run merge; confirm collision count under 0.5%.
3. Review the flagged-pairs report. Anything ambiguous goes to the data stewards, not you.
4. Execute the merge job. Do not interrupt mid-pass.
5. Unfreeze writes, verify row counts match the ledger.
6. Tag and sign the release artifact before publishing to the Dunmore registry. Sign with the deploy key below.

release key, fajef-kajeg: bky19_LdLu6Ne6FLi8he2c24d

## Runbook: CSV Import Wizard

The Fennick import wizard accepts CSVs up to 20MB, validates headers, and stages rows before commit. Uploads are virus-scanned; rejected files purge after 24 hours. Staged rows carry the uploader's session ID for audit. Security review should confirm staging-table permissions, accessed via the connection string below.

warehouse DSN: mongodb://prair_svc:Sa7NQM1@db-329b.merlaqcorp.corp:5432/fendor

- [ ] Before the Quillhaven signing ceremony proceeds, run the leaked-file-descriptor hunt on the offline signer. As a new contractor, please be thorough: enumerate every open descriptor on the sealed host, confirm nothing points at the ceremony scratch volume, and log each finding in the Larkspur register. If any descriptor traces back to the retired Fenwick exporter, halt and page the ceremony lead. Once the host shows a clean descriptor table, unlock the escrow envelope using the phrase below.

unlock words, yajof-tagef: aldiel-kasath-briax-fraeth-pelius-olieth-pelix-wenius-wenael-norael

**Ticket QV-2184: Dual-write gap during Ledgerline schema migration**

Support team: customers on the Ledgerline plan may see stale invoice columns for up to 90 seconds while the expand-contract migration runs. This is expected — we add the new column, backfill in batches of 500, then flip reads. No downtime occurs, but brief read skew is possible. If a customer reports mismatched totals, note the timestamp and escalate to the Datapath squad. The relevant trace token is below.

session token of tajef-bageg = htk21_5d90d574934f3ccae6437